Església i Palau del Temple, Neoclassical church and palace in Ciutat Vella, Valencia, Spain.
The Església i Palau del Temple is a neoclassical church and palace in Valencia's old town, marked by a restrained facade with Corinthian columns and a central dome. Natural light from the dome fills the interior spaces, creating bright and open areas throughout the structure.
Construction of this religious complex started in 1761 under King Charles III's order and progressed in stages. The church was completed in 1770, with the full complex finished by 1785.
This site housed the Order of Montesa and now serves as administrative offices for the Valencian region. The blend of religious and governmental uses shows how historical spaces adapt to new purposes over time.
The building sits on Plaza del Temple 2 in the old town near other historical sites, making it easy to explore multiple places in one area. Keep in mind that this is an active government office, so not all areas may be open to visitors at all times.
The Chapel of Communion contains exceptional marble work and architectural details inspired by Michelangelo's design principles. Visitors often overlook this intimate space despite it being one of the most refined areas inside.
